Application of Steam Boiler Furnace in Power Generation and Chemical Processing Scenarios



Steam boiler furnace, as an important thermal equipment, plays a crucial role in modern industry. Its main function is to heat water into steam by burning fuel or other energy sources, thereby generating high-pressure steam for various industrial processes. In the fields of power generation and chemical processing, the application of the new steam boiler is particularly widespread, which not only improves production efficiency but also promotes efficient utilization of resources.

 

In the power generation industry, the steam boiler furnace, as one of the core equipment of thermal power plants, works by burning fuels such as coal, natural gas, or biomass to generate high-temperature and high-pressure steam

 

These vapors then drive turbine generators to achieve the conversion and output of electrical energy. Thermal power generation is an important source of global electricity supply, and the efficient operation of diesel steam boilers directly affects the economy and environmental friendliness of power plants. In recent years, the research and application of new and efficient steam boiler furnaces have continuously improved power generation efficiency while reducing greenhouse gas emissions, meeting the requirements of sustainable development. In addition, the use of advanced technologies such as circulating fluidized bed boilers and supercritical boilers can not only effectively utilize low-grade coal resources, but also expand the utilization range of more renewable energy and solid waste.

 

In the chemical processing industry, steam boiler furnace also plays an indispensable role

 

Many chemical processes require a stable heat source to keep the reaction going smoothly. Steam can be used for various chemical operations such as heating, distillation, extraction, etc., especially in the fields of petrochemicals, pharmaceuticals, and food processing. The steam generated by boilers provides the necessary thermal energy for industrial production. For example, in the process of petroleum refining, steam is used to heat crude oil and other chemical feedstocks to promote fractionation and cracking reactions, thereby producing a variety of high value-added chemicals. The effective use of autoclave boiler not only improves the temperature control accuracy of the production process, but also optimizes the reaction conditions to a certain extent, improving the quality and yield of the product.

 

It should be noted that the most efficient steam boiler must follow the principles of safety production during use. Excessive pressure and temperature may cause equipment damage or even explosion, therefore, the design, manufacturing, and maintenance of boilers must comply with strict standards and procedures. In addition, with the continuous development of technology, the automation level of boilers is gradually improving. Through intelligent monitoring systems, steam parameters and operating status can be monitored in real time, improving their safety and reliability.

 

In summary, the application of Steam Boiler Furnace in the fields of power generation and chemical processing not only provides strong thermal support for modern industry, but also plays an important role in improving production efficiency, reducing energy consumption and emissions. With the continuous advancement of technology, the application prospects of steam boiler furnace are still broad, which will promote the sustainable development of industry at a deeper level.
